Overview

Postcode NE2 2JE is located in a major urban area, within the South Jesmond ward of Newcastle upon Tyne in the North East region, and forms part of the North Jesmond area. It has very low deprivation and very low crime levels, with around 23.1 crimes per 1,000 residents per year, about 80% below the North East average of 117 per 1,000. The average income per household in North Jesmond is £63,024 per year. The nearest station is Manors, about 1.1 miles away. There are 8 primary and 1 secondary schools in the area. There are 2 parks nearby, the closest large park is Jesmond Dene.
